1. Global challenges and solutions
This week's "Science" (Science Vol 360, Issue 6390 , 18 May 2018) the focus of the journal due to excessive or long-term use of various antibiotics, pesticides and herbicides, lead, or will soon face without facing mankind The dilemma available for medicine. To this end, scientists have expressed their opinions and proposed various programs.
In "Abominable Evolution: Can we get rid of the sociobiology dilemma caused by insecticide resistance? The evidence presented in the article indicates that the evolution of insects and weeds exceeds the speed at which humans develop new chemicals. Therefore, the authors point out that ecological, genetic, economic, and socio-political factors must be put together for consideration, and there is hope to solve this problem.
The use of genomic techniques to analyze the emergence and spread of antibacterial pathogens is based on genome-wide sequencing (WGS) technology to reveal the inherent regularity of antimicrobial resistance (AMR) in bacterial pathogens in time and space. It is proposed to use this rule to more effectively use existing and future antimicrobial agents and to extend their life cycle.
Prospects for bioremediation and detoxification using biologics pin their hopes on the metabolic plasticity of prokaryotes and suggest that they can be used for bioremediation and environmental toxic substances, such as wastewater treatment to habitat restoration. .
The Global Challenges of Antifungal Drug Resistance to Human Health and Food Security also pointed out that in order to avoid the global collapse of the ability of humans to control fungal infections, we must strengthen the management of existing chemicals and accelerate new resistance. The development of fungal drugs and the use of emerging technologies to find alternative solutions.
